Under the Code of Criminal Procedure, 1973, Section 200 dealt with "Examination of complainant". Since 1 July 2024, the corresponding provision is Section 223 of the Bharatiya Nagarik Suraksha Sanhita, 2023. - When did this change come into force?
- The replacement came into force on 1 July 2024. Matters registered before that date continue under the Code of Criminal Procedure, 1973.
